Eileen LaVerne Grieb was born January 15, 1931 near Spink in rural Union County, SD, to parents Arnold and Frances (Christensen) Anderson. She died September 18, 2013 at Bethesda Nursing Home in Beresford, SD at the age of 82 years. Eileen attended Brule Creek district #50 and then began working in homes in the area helping families and later at the Children's Hospital in Sioux Falls. She moved to California where she worked as a nurse's aid at Washington Township Hospital in Fremont. She married Charles Grieb on January 16, 1965. The couple lived in California, Pennsylvania, Washington, and Oregon. In 1971 they moved to Beresford where Eileen worked as a custodian for the Beresford School and Crossroads Motel. Eileen was a member of Brooklyn Evangelical Free Church where she helped in the nursery and was the secretary for WMS. In her free time she enjoyed doing word search puzzles and watching baseball and football on TV with the Oakland A's and Raiders as her favorite teams.
